Ethereum
Block
21286068
0x968da3e1bdbd6fe68b87b56825740fcce4489024
EOA
Active on
Ethereum with -- and
36 txns
Funded by
0x21f5
…
7167
via
0x8e44
…
abc5
First active
6 years ago
Last active
5 years ago
Loading...